Understanding Johnsongrass

Before we dive into the methods for controlling Johnsongrass, it’s essential to understand the characteristics of this weed. Johnsongrass (Sorghum halepense) is a perennial grass that can grow up to 6 feet tall. It has a deep root system, which makes it challenging to eradicate. Johnsongrass can produce thousands of seeds per plant, which can be dispersed by wind, water, or animals. It can also propagate through underground rhizomes, allowing it to spread quickly.

Why is Johnsongrass a Problem?

Johnsongrass is a significant problem for several reasons. It can:

  • Outcompete native vegetation for water, nutrients, and light
  • Reduce crop yields and lower the quality of harvested crops
  • Increase the risk of wildfires by providing a continuous fuel source
  • Harbor pests and diseases that can affect crops and other plants
  • Interfere with irrigation and drainage systems

How can I prevent Johnsongrass from spreading to new areas?

Preventing Johnsongrass from spreading to new areas requires careful planning and attention to detail. One of the most important steps is to prevent the spread of seed, which can be done by removing seed heads from the plant before they produce seed. This can be done by mowing or cutting the plant, and then removing the seed heads. Additionally, using a physical barrier, such as a tarp or landscape fabric, can help to prevent seed from being dispersed into new areas.

It is also important to be careful when moving equipment or vehicles into areas where Johnsongrass is present, as the seed can become attached to tires or other surfaces and be transported to new areas. Cleaning equipment and vehicles thoroughly before moving them to new areas can help to prevent the spread of Johnsongrass. Additionally, using weed-free seed and plant materials can help to prevent the introduction of Johnsongrass into new areas. By taking these precautions, it is possible to prevent Johnsongrass from spreading to new areas and reducing the economic and environmental impacts of this invasive weed.

How can I get rid of Johnsongrass in my lawn or garden?

Getting rid of Johnsongrass in your lawn or garden requires a combination of physical removal and prevention. The first step is to physically remove the plant, either by digging it up or using an herbicide to kill it. It is important to remove as much of the root system as possible, as Johnsongrass can regrow from small pieces of root left behind. Additionally, removing the seed heads can help to prevent the spread of Johnsongrass to other areas of the lawn or garden.

After removing the Johnsongrass, it is important to take steps to prevent it from coming back. This can be done by improving the health and density of the lawn or garden, making it more difficult for Johnsongrass to become established. Using a pre-emergent herbicide in the spring can also help to prevent Johnsongrass from germinating. Additionally, monitoring the area regularly and removing any new seedlings or regrowth can help to prevent Johnsongrass from re-establishing itself. By using a combination of these methods, it is possible to effectively get rid of Johnsongrass in your lawn or garden and prevent it from becoming a major problem.
